**Ticket #7730 — Vault sealed, tenant quota updates blocked**

The Lanternfell quota service can't push per-tenant rate limits because the Ashgrove vault auto-sealed during the 02:00 rotation. Until it's unsealed, all tenants fall back to default quotas, and two large accounts are already throttling. On-call should unseal via the standby node, confirm the quota sync job resumes, then close this ticket. Unseal with the recovery passphrase below.

unlock words, bawip-taduf: casix-belael-norael-silwyn

Ticket HX-412: Export retries failing on staging

So the retry worker on the Pondermill staging box keeps dying because someone copied the prod env file but stripped half the vars. Failed exports just pile up in the dead-letter table and never get retried. Fix is easy: the worker needs its queue credential defined before it boots. Future maintainers, don't remove this again. The required line goes right below this note.

env line for kageg-fajof: COURIER_KEY5=93d14

The Q3 cash-flow forecast shows operating inflows tracking 6% above plan, offset by accelerated capital spend on the Morrow Street fit-out. Net position remains positive through the quarter, with a tighter window in week nine as supplier payments cluster. Departments should hold discretionary purchases until mid-quarter and flag any commitments above the usual threshold to Finance. A confidential item relevant to planning appears directly below this note.

board note of bawep-tajef: Queniusek Systems plans to raise the Quenvan list price by 53.1 percent in March. The pricing group signed off on a budget of $176.4 million for Project Drueth. The renewal with Casionix Partners closes at $142.5 million a year, 8.3 percent below the last contract. Project Fraax slips by six weeks because of the tooling delay.

During load tests of the Marlowe checkout flow, the synthetic-traffic gate may lock out the staging payment simulator if error rates exceed threshold. On-call engineers should first attempt a soft reset via the Marlowe console. If the simulator remains locked after two attempts, break-glass access is authorized. Document your reason in the incident channel, note the timestamp, and notify the capacity lead afterward. The recovery passphrase for unlocking the simulator vault is below.

unlock words, yawig-kagef: gordor-holvan-ulaael-pramir-ulaiel-tamdor